Iron Mike, Sly feted

Mike Tyson broke down in tears and cut short his speech while Sylvester Stallone proclaimed “Yo, Adrian, I did it!” as the two stars from different fields were inducted into the International Boxing Hall of Fame in Canastota, N.Y., on Sunday. Mexican champ Julio Cesar Chavez, Russian-born junior welterweight Kostya Tszyu, Mexican trainer Ignacio “Nacho” Beristain and referee Joe Cortez also were inducted. Tyson tried to honor the late trainer Cus D’Amato, who became his legal guardian after Tyson’s mother died and taught him the sweet science. But his eyes welled with tears and he apologized and walked away from the dais after only a moment or two.
